Output d8a51692f22ee8c8161853a14ccf50d4c6e38ded6dc8b0e3dfc9f578dadb01b9:0

value
23891505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07215e371cc19ed5ab31d3493d740737c97697b OP_EQUAL
address
3LhB9F7SbX92k43W1jZpU4iWUsvLuw5ugy
transaction
d8a51692f22ee8c8161853a14ccf50d4c6e38ded6dc8b0e3dfc9f578dadb01b9
spent
true